                            SENATE RESOLUTION NO. 789
 WHEREAS, The Senate of the State of Texas is pleased to
 welcome the members of the Texas-Israel Chamber of Commerce and
 to join them in celebrating May 8, 2013, as Texas-Israel Day at
 the State Capitol; and
 WHEREAS, The people of Texas and the people of Israel share
 many values and interests, and the growing business between the
 two plays an important role in their respective economies; and
 WHEREAS, The major areas of interest that bind Texas and
 Israel are energy, water, and health; examples of the beneficial
 relationship between the two include the discovery of natural gas
 in Israel by Noble Energy and Texas' use of groundbreaking
 Israeli water technology to help the state solve its ongoing
 water problems; and
 WHEREAS, In light of the joint economic and developmental
 activities in which Texas and Israel are participating, it is
 truly fitting that a day be set aside to celebrate their
 longstanding friendship and to foster an even closer
 relationship; now, therefore, be it
 RESOLVED, That the Senate of the State of Texas, 83rd
 Legislature, hereby welcome the members of the Texas-Israel
 Chamber of Commerce to Austin and extend to them best wishes
 for a productive Texas-Israel Day at the State Capitol; and, be
 it further
 RESOLVED, That a copy of this Resolution be prepared in
 honor of this special occasion.
